Maya Rudolph performs Prince tribute concert

Maya Rudolph

The purifying waters of Lake Minnetonka have overcome Maya Rudolph.

Last night (September 20), the Saturday Night alumni joined The Roots on stage in Brooklyn to perform a tribute concert to Prince and will hit the stage again tonight for a second show dedicated to the Purple One with the hip-hop group at the Capitol Theatre in Port Chester, New York.

Rudolph, who is the daughter of singer Minnie Ripperton, recently appeared on the chat show Late Night with Jimmy Fallon to perform a rendition of Prince's controversial single "Darling Nikki" with the Roots and and her friend Gretchen Lieberum. The actress also told Fallon that she and Lieberum were in a band together called SuperSauce during college at UC Santa Cruz.
